EFFECT

The magician shows a simple cord and a solid ring.  Both are seen to be quite normal and yet the magician amazingly passes the ring on and off the cord without any cover whatsoever in an unexplainable way.

Finally he holds the cord in one hand and the ring in the other which is then thrown through the air only to mysteriously pass onto the cord. Staggering!
